Steel pipes are long and hollow tubes that are used for� many different applications in a variety of places. Such as conveying fluids and powdery solids, exchanging heat, making machine parts and containers and so on. It is also an economical type of steel and� its versatility makes pipes the most often used product that is produced by the steel industry. Steel pipe production technology development began with the rise of the bicycle manufacturing, development of oil in the early years of the 19th century, two world war ships, boilers, aircraft manufacturing, after the second world war thermal power boiler manufacturing, chemical industry and the development of oil and gas drilling and transportation, effectively driving the steel pipe industry in the development of varieties, yield and quality. Steel pipe can be divided into two categories according to the production method: seamless steel pipe and seam steel pipe, seam steel pipe is divided into straight seam steel pipe and spiral seam welded pipe.
